Mark Reynier of Renegade Spirits has transformed the former Guinness brewery in Waterford Ireland, into the Waterford Distillery. They have decided to distinguish their Irish Whiskey by dropping the "e." The first Whisky ran in January 2016.
βAfter maturing for several years in the best of French and American oak, we believe these component βsingleβ, single malts, each one exhibiting its own nuances, will come together making the most profound single malt whisky ever createdβ (Waterford Distillery).
